The operating system for autonomous AI agents. Scheduling, messaging, agent discovery, and a browser-based command center. One person can ship like a team.

Install

npm install -g dorkos

Quick Start

export ANTHROPIC_API_KEY=your-key-here
dorkos

Your browser opens. You're looking at every Claude Code session across all your projects: sessions you started from the CLI, from VS Code, from anywhere. One place. Every session. Already there.

Tasks - Scheduling

Cron-based and on-demand agent execution, independent of your IDE or terminal. Your agents ship code, triage issues, and run audits on schedule. You wake up to completed pull requests.

  • File-based task definitions alongside your code
  • Isolated sessions per run with full history
  • Configurable concurrency limits
  • Overrun protection prevents duplicate runs

Relay - Communication

Built-in messaging between your agents and the channels you already use. Telegram, webhooks, browser. Agents reach you where you are. Agents can also message each other across project boundaries.

  • Telegram and webhook adapters built in
  • Add new channels with a plugin, no custom bots required
  • Messages persist when terminals close
  • Your research agent can notify your coding agent. No copy-paste required.

Mesh - Agent Discovery

Scans your projects and finds agent-capable directories. You approve which agents join the network. They coordinate through channels you define.

  • Finds Claude Code, Cursor, and Codex projects automatically
  • Each agent gets an identity: name, color, icon, purpose
  • Agents know about each other: what they can do and how to reach them
  • From solo agents to a coordinated team

Console - Browser UI

Your agents have names, colors, and status. Glance at your browser tabs and know which ones are working, which are done, and which need your attention.

Start a session from the browser. Check on it from your phone. Resume it from inside Obsidian. Every session, regardless of which client started it, visible in one place.

  • Rich markdown rendering with full session history
  • Approve or deny tool calls from any device
  • Cmd+K / Ctrl+K command palette with agent switching and fuzzy search
  • Real-time sync across multiple clients
  • Available in any browser or embedded in Obsidian

Architecture

DorkOS is a Turborepo monorepo with a hexagonal architecture. A Transport interface decouples the React client from its backend, with adapters for HTTP/SSE (standalone web) and in-process (Obsidian plugin).

Package Description
apps/client React 19 SPA (Vite 6, Tailwind 4, shadcn/ui)
apps/server Express API with Claude Agent SDK integration
apps/site Marketing site and docs (Next.js 16, Fumadocs)
packages/cli Publishable npm CLI (esbuild bundle)
packages/shared Zod schemas, types, transport interface
packages/db Drizzle ORM schemas (SQLite)
packages/relay Inter-agent message bus
packages/mesh Agent discovery and registry

Documentation

Interactive API docs at /api/docs (Scalar UI) and raw OpenAPI spec at /api/openapi.json.

Development

git clone https://github.com/dork-labs/dorkos.git
cd dorkos
pnpm install
cp .env.example .env  # Add your ANTHROPIC_API_KEY
pnpm dev

This starts the Express server on port 6242 and the Vite dev server on port 6241.

Docker

docker build -f Dockerfile.run --build-arg INSTALL_MODE=npm -t dorkos .
docker run --rm -p 4242:4242 \
  -e ANTHROPIC_API_KEY=your-key-here \
  -e DORKOS_HOST=0.0.0.0 \
  dorkos
